2007-01-01から1年間の記事一覧

読み始めました!

ActionScript 3.0 アニメーション作者: Keith Peters,永井勝則出版社/メーカー: ボーンデジタル発売日: 2007/10/30メディア: 単行本購入: 19人 クリック: 431回この商品を含むブログ (45件) を見る昨日から読み始めました。 本の最初の方にはActionScript3.0…

遂に出ました!

[rakuten:book:12522272:detail] 本日、購入してきました。 曲げセンサ、赤外線センサ、LEDアレイを光らせるなど、とても興味深い内容です。 これはかなり楽しめそう! このGainer本の近くに、こんな本が置いてありました。ActionScript 3.0 アニメーション…

GAINER本が発売!

『MASHUP++』でおなじみの九天社さんから、今月末に『+GAINER』という書籍が発売されるみたいです。 GainerとFlashを使って何か楽しいことをしたい! って方には、もってこいの本。 電子回路の基礎知識から、Gainerを使った作品の作り方まで掲載されているみ…

ヒアドキュメント

PHP

PHPで長い文字列を出力(または変数に代入)する際、文字列を連結する演算子「.」を使って、長々と記述するよりは、ヒアドキュメントを使った方が視覚的にも分かりやすい。 このスクリプトを実行すると、画面には「私の名前は山田太郎です。メールアドレスは…

Water

現在、東京ミッドタウン内の21_21 DESIGN SIGHTで『Water』という企画展が開催されている。 ロッテ・キシリトールガムや明治・おいしい牛乳などのデザインを手掛けた佐藤卓さんが、ディレクションされています。 一昨日TBSで放送された『情熱大陸』にも出演…

XMLファイルの作成

XMLファイルを作成する場合、DreamWeaverや他のテキストエディタなどで、コピペを繰り返して地道に作成していくことが多いのではないだろうか? そんなやり方に飽きてしまった場合、XMLファイルを吐き出してくれるMovableTypeなどのCMSを使ってみるのはどう…

おさらい

まずXMLファイルを用意する。ファイル名はlist.xml。 <sports> <soccer>サッカー</soccer> <basketball>バスケットボール</basketball> <football>アメリカンフットボール</football> <soccer>フットサル</soccer> <swim>水泳</swim> </sports>そんでもって今回はXMLファイルからXPathを使って「soccer」だけリストアップしてみる。 import mx.xpath.XPathAPI; var my_xm…

おさらい

FlashでXMLを読み込むおさらい。まずXMLファイルを用意する。ファイル名はlist.xml。 <sports> <soccer>サッカー</soccer> <basketball>バスケットボール</basketball> <football>アメリカンフットボール</football> <tennis>テニス</tennis> <swim>水泳</swim> </sports>そんでもってFlashを起動し、1フレーム目に以下のスクリプトを記述。 var my_xml:XML = new XML(); my_…

ひとつ上のプレゼン。

ひとつ上のプレゼン。作者: 眞木準出版社/メーカー: インプレス発売日: 2005/03/03メディア: 単行本購入: 4人 クリック: 124回この商品を含むブログ (52件) を見る考具が読み終わったので、今は『ひとつ上のプレゼン。』という本を読んでいます。 この本も前…

考具

考具 ―考えるための道具、持っていますか?作者: 加藤昌治出版社/メーカー: CCCメディアハウス発売日: 2003/04/04メディア: 単行本(ソフトカバー)購入: 37人 クリック: 305回この商品を含むブログ (291件) を見るずっーと前から、読もう読もうと思っていた…

Mash up Caravan in Tokyo

昨日、Mash up Caravan in Tokyoに参加してきました。 『Mash up Award 3rd』というイベントに向けたセミナーで、主に開発者向けといった感じでした。 内容も、Flash、Ruby、JavaScriptなど盛り沢山。 盛り沢山になった結果、一つ一つのセッションがちょっと…

配列に関すること

配列で、ド忘れしていたことが… 調べなおしたので、忘れずにメモしておくことにします。 ●配列の頭に付け加える //スポーツという配列を作成 var sports:Array = new Array("soccer","baseball","football"); var added:Number = sports.unshift("swimming")…

最近読んでいる本

FLASH OOP (Advanced Web design books)作者: Flash OOPJapan,株式会社バスキュール,加藤達雄出版社/メーカー: 翔泳社発売日: 2004/06/16メディア: 単行本 クリック: 21回この商品を含むブログ (33件) を見る随分前に読んだときには、チンプンカンプンだった…

第一回東京てらこ

先週の日曜日に、trick7のteraさん主催の「東京てらこ」に参加してきました。 参加者のみなさんは、スゴイレベルの方たちばかりで、「大丈夫か、俺…」なんて思ってしまいました。 今回の目的は、GainerをFlashで動かすってことだったんですが… 電子回路超〜…

とりあえず…

仕事帰りに書籍『MASHUP++』とチョロQ(QSTEER)を購入してきました。 QSTEERにはスターターセットとハイパフォーマンスセットの二種類。 スターターセットは定価1280円みたいですが、私が購入した家電量販店では980円でした。 ハイパフォーマンスセットは、…

MASHUPのお勉強

MASHUP++作者: 鹿倉公維,澤久裕昭,原央樹,セトウナオ,タナカミノル,三宅涼,宮下剛輔,さうなまん出版社/メーカー: 九天社発売日: 2007/03メディア: 単行本 クリック: 170回この商品を含むブログ (7件) を見るMASHUPについて書かれている本。 GainerとFlashを…

巨大化する蝶

Fuse Kitを使って、サンプルを作成してみた。 →巨大化する蝶のサンプルを見る 作成には以下の手順を踏んでいます。 蝶をステージに配置(インスタンス名を「butterfly_mc」にしています) 新規レイヤー「script」を作成 作成したscriptレイヤーの1フレーム目に…

ダウンロード

Fuse Kitを使うにあたり、まずは必要なファイルをMosesSupposesよりダウンロード。 ダウンロードしたZIPファイルを展開する。 展開したファイルをHDに移して、Flashの環境設定→ActionScript→ActionScript 2.0設定→クラスパスで、クラスパスを設定する。 そう…

Fuse Kitを使ってみようかなぁ…

便利だという噂のFuse Kitを使ってみようかなぁ… と思っております。 やってみないことには、何とも言えませんよね。

Tweenクラスの使用

Flash 8 にはTweenクラスというものが用意されている。通常はプロパティインスペクタからTweenの設定を行うが、このクラスを使用すれば、ActionScriptのみで制御出来る。 詳しくはFlashのヘルプの以下の場所を参照してください。 TransitionManagerクラスと …

Chocolate

本日から21_21 DESIGN SIGHTで新しいプログラムが始まりました。 深澤直人さんディレクションによる『Chocolate』という企画展です。 チョコレートを題材に、約30名のデザイナーが独自の表現(写真、映像、立体など)を発表するみたいです。 7月29日まで開催…

オブジェクトの作成

新しくオブジェクトを作成する場合、二通りの方法がある。 作成するオブジェクトを「myobj」とする。 ActionScript1.0で書く場合 var myobj = {}; var myobj = new Object(); ActionScript2.0で書く場合 var myobj:Object = {}; var myobj:Object = new Obje…

CSS Nite Shuffle

4月16日(月)に行われたCSS Nite Shuffle。 下記ブログ内にて、そのレポートを毎日少しずつアップしています。 興味のある方はご覧ください。 →WEB&DTP演習(FC2ブログ)

○×クイズ

Flashで○×クイズを作ってみました。 問題とか回答とかは、外部XMLファイルに記述しています。 そうすることで、修正時にいちいちflaファイルを開かなくていいので便利。 当初ボタンはコンポーネントのボタンを使おうと思ったんですが、コンポーネントを使う…

21_21 DESIGN SIGHT

東京ミッドタウン内の21_21 DESIGN SIGHTに行ってきた。 そこで開催されている安藤忠雄の『2006年の現場 悪戦苦闘』を見てきました。 いやー、良かった。 単なる写真展といった展示ではなく、実際にプレゼンに使用したミニチュアや、手書きのイラスト、設計…

変数の型を調べる

変数を使用して、その型を調べたいときにはtypeof()を使う。 使い方は以下の通り。 //aに文字列"hello"を代入 a = "hello"; //変数aの型を調べる trace(typeof(a)); 出力パネルには文字列なので「string」と表示される。 変数の値が数値の場合は「number」と…

不都合な真実

映画『不都合な真実』のエンドロール直前に、スクリーンに映し出されたエフェクトを早速Flashで再現してみた。 映画をご覧になった方なら、「あぁ、あれね」と思っていただけるかと。 これを実際に使うときには、事前の準備が必要だなぁ。 どの順番で単語を…

箱の中から文字が…

以前にFlashで作成した転がる立方体。 それに手を加えてみました。 クリックすると動き出し、止まると同時に蓋が開き、中から文字が出てくる。 文字をクリックすると、指定されたURLにジャンプするとかもありかな。 いろいろ応用が利きそうだな。 →蓋が開き…

プログレスバーの設置

MovableTypeで作成したサイトのFlashムービーに修正を加えてみた。 プログレスバーを設置し、ムービー自体にも動きをつけ、それまでFlash内にあったナビゲーションのボタンを、XHTMLとCSSで作り直した。 swfファイル自体の容量がそれほど大きくないので、プ…

擬似3D

数日前に作成した転がる立方体に、修正を加えてみた。 クリックすると動き出すように変更。あとシャドウも付けてみました。 前よりは3Dっぽくなったかなぁとは思うけど、まだまだだなぁ… →3Dっぽくしてみた立方体のMovie